When he was running for President, Barack Obama told us there would be no compromise on Net neutrality. He said it many more times. - Last May, President Obama named Tom Wheeler to be FCC chairman. - Wheeler had been the top gun for both the National Cable and Telecommunications Association (NCTA) and the Cellular Telecommunications and Internet Association (CTIA), lobbyists for the cable and wireless industries. - the FCC meets on May 15.
